Abstract

A method for improving the performance of fracturing processes in oil production fields may rely on polymer coated particles carried in the fracturing fluid. The particles may include heavy substrates, such as sand, ceramic sand, or the like coated with polymers selected to absorb water, increasing the area and volume to travel more readily with the flow of fluid without settling out, or allowing the substrate to settle out. Ultimately, the substrate may become lodged in the fissures formed by the pressure or hydraulic fracturing, resulting in propping open of the fissures for improved productivity.

Claims (10)

1. A method for forming polymer-coated substrate particles, the method comprising:

mixing substrate particles with a synthetic binder so that at least a portion of the substrate particles are at least partly covered with the synthetic binder, the synthetic binder comprising a first volume of polyacrylamide wetted with a solvent, wherein a ratio of the synthetic binder to the substrate particles is from about 0.25 wt. % to about 3.0 wt. %;

coating the at least the portion of the substrate particles with a second volume of polyacrylamide in powdered form to form polymer-coated substrate particles; and

drying at least a portion of the synthetic binder present on the polymer-coated substrate particles, wherein, when the polymer-coated substrate particles are submerged in water, at least a portion of the second volume of polyacrylamide is configured to swell, thereby increasing a fluid drag of the polymer-coated substrate particles compared to a fluid drag of the substrate particles so that the polymer-coated substrate particles are able to flow into a fissure by way of a carrier fluid and prop open the fissure so that the fissure remains open for extracting a fluid through the fissure.

2.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the water-absorbing polymer comprises polyacrylate.

3.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the substrate particles comprise sand.

4.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the at least a portion of the second volume of polyacrylamide is configured to form a gel when exposed to water.

5.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the outer polymeric coating comprises a co-polymer that includes an acrylamide, an acrylate, or a combination thereof.

6. The method according to claim 3 , wherein the synthetic binder is configured to adhere the at least a portion of the second volume of polyacrylamide to at least a portion of the sand.

7. The method of claim 1 , wherein a size of the substrate particles is at or between 30 to 100 mesh.
